Abstract

1,020,402. Grabs for handling materials. POCLAIN. May 14, 1964 [June 11, 1963], No. 20231/64. Headings B8H and B8J. In a grab comprising two jaws articulated symmetrically about the bottom of a frame, the jaws are moved in synchronism by two doubleacting jacks 12, 13 articulated to the upper end of the frame and to each of the jaws. The jacks are operated in synchronism by balancing the flow of hydraulic fluid to each. In the embodiment of Fig. 2 the jacks are placed in series in the fluid circuit, the chamber 13a of jack 13 on the piston rod side of the piston 11a being in fluid communication with the chamber 12b of jack 12 on the side of piston 10a remote from the piston rod 10. The piston area of the chamber 12b is equal to the effective piston area of the chamber 13a, hence with displacement of the piston 11a, the piston 10a is displaced an equal amount in the same direction causing a synchronized movement of the grab jaws in either direction. The spring- loaded valves 19, 31 and 17, 30 are incorporated in each piston 11a, 10a to cause a balance of fluid pressure in each jack at the end of each stroke, the appropriate valve stems 19a, 31a, 17a, 30a engaging the end walls of the jack cylinders to open the downstream valves and the increased fluid pressure on the upstream valves opening the same. In the embodiment of Fig. 3 the two jacks are placed in parallel in the fluid circuit, the supply flow being balanced by a flow divider 23. The latter is supplied from a fluid pipe 26 and the fluid passes into a chamber containing a freely moving piston 29 via ducts 27, 28 and equal constricted orifices 27a, 28a. Any excessive resistance to the travel of one of the jacks causes the piston 29 to move and restrict the supply of fluid to the other jack, whereupon a synchronism of jack movement is effected. Non-return valves 32, 33 are provided in the flow divider to permit discharge of fluid from the jacks when they move in the opposite direction. In the latter case fluid is supplied to the jacks by pipes 24, 25 which also may be coupled to a further flow divider.
